The Circus Train coming out of LANE onto the NEC for its handoff from NS to Amtrak. NS 5610 was rebuilt from GP38 NS 2820 (née SOU 2820).
A pair of Amtrak GP38s heading east on Track 1 through North Elizabeth. These engines were on protect duty for the Circus Train handoff from NS to Amtrak.
